Flawless, radiant skin with a velvet finish? A lot of products were needed to even come close! To mimic the luminosity of the center of the face, I started by applying a layer of MAC NW 10 concealer from MACs Pro Conceal and Correct Palette in “Light” (Review here). This Concealer is way lighter than my face, so it worked as a non-shimmery highlight.

On top of that I applied a layer of MAC Studio Waterweight SPF 30 Foundation in NC 15 (Review here). As that one is only light to medium coverage, I went back in with the Collection Lasting Perfection Concealer in “Fair” to hide hyper pigmentation and spots and finally set everything with a generous amount of the Clarins Loose Powder in “Translucent”.

The powder really gave a beautiful velvet finish, so I topped it up with a little bit of Me, Me, Me Beat the Blues liquid highlighter in “Sunbeam” on my cheekbones and the base was done.

The eyes were fairly easy. I applied a silvery-gray eyeshadow all over the mobile lid and blended it out using the “lid” shade from the Revlon Eyeshadow Palette in “Impressionist” (Review here) a little further up than my crease.

I then smudged a black pencil eyeliner along the upper and lower waterline (mine is from Maybelline, but so rubbed off I cant tell you the exact name) and used a push liner brush to drag it out on the outer and inner corners.

A coating of Clinique High Impact mascara in “Black” (Review here). Perfect, as the lashes on the model were looking pretty natural.

Yes, the Manhattan X-treme Last & Shine lipstick in 54 V again! I am well aware that I have used it in the last two looks already, but the color is just so versatile.

To get a more brown tone, I used the MAC lip pencil in “Draw me close” all over my lips and applied the lipstick on top with a lip brush. As you can easily see in the pictures above, I am useless at staying inside the lines when coloring, so please excuse the slightly smudged upper lip…
